WebTo find the unit vector u of the vector you divide that vector by its magnitude as follows: Note that this formula uses scalar multiplication, because the numerator is a vector and … WebSep 17, 2024 · Then, we call →u a unit vector if it has length 1, that is if ‖→u‖ = 1 Let →v be a vector in Rn. Then, the vector →u which has the same direction as →v but length equal to 1 is the corresponding unit vector of →v. This vector is given by →u = 1 ‖→v‖→v We often use the term normalize to refer to this process.
WebThe given vector is a = i + 2 j + 2 k. Its magnitude is, a = √ (1 2 + 2 2 + 2 2) = √9 = 3. The unit vector parallel to a is: ^a a ^ = a / a = ( i + 2 j + 2 k) / 3 = (1/3) i + (2/3) j + (2/3) k Answer: The required unit vector is (1/3) i + (2/3) j + (2/3) k. And the formulas of dot product, cross product, projection of vectors, are performed across … the god of high school myanimeWebDec 20, 2024 · A vector is called a unit vector if it has magnitude = 1. If v = a, b Then the unit vector in the direction of v can be found below. Definition: The Unit Vector in the Direction of v u = 1 v v Example 1.1.5 The unit vector in the direction of − 3, 1 is − 3 √10, 1 √10.
